@article{fdi:010071940, title = {{U}nsatisfactory results of the {T}unisian universal salt iodization program on national iodine levels}, author = {{D}oggui, {R}. and {E}l {A}ti-{H}ellal, {M}. and {T}raissac, {P}ierre and {E}l {A}ti, {J}.}, editor = {}, language = {{ENG}}, abstract = {{L}ack of iodine intake may promote a spectrum of disorders termed iodine deficiency disorders. {U}niversal salt iodization laws were adopted in {T}unisia to overcome this problem. {T}his study examines the adequacy of iodized salt in the distribution chain two decades after its last assessment. {A} cross-sectional design was carried out in 2012 using the multi-stage cluster sampling technique. {S}alt samples from 24 govemorates were collected at wholesaler level (n = 635), retailer level (n = 1440) and household level (n = 1560), and analyzed using a validated iodometric titration method. {I}odine concentration at each level of distribution chain was within the recommended range of 15-27 mg/kg. {I}odine content in household salt was significantly different according to the salt manufacturer and also between geographical regions (p < 0,0001). {M}oreover, an insufficient coverage of adequately iodized salt consumption (less than 90%) was found with reference to international standards (>= 15 mg/kg). {A}bout 85.6% (95%{CI}: 78.3-90.8) of analyzed samples were adequately iodized at the intermediate levels of supply-chain (wholesalers and retailers). {O}ur study demonstrates a decrease in the availability of iodized salt in households. {I}t can thus be concluded that universal salt iodization legislation has not been sufficient to ensure an adequate supply of iodine in the population, and an evaluation system needs to be reactivated.}, keywords = {{F}ood composition ; {F}ood analysis ; {F}ood safety ; {R}egulatory issues in ; {T}unisia ; {F}ortification ; {D}ietary intake ; {E}dible salt ; {I}odized salt ; {I}odine ; {P}otassium iodate ; {TUNISIE}}, booktitle = {}, journal = {{J}ournal of {F}ood {C}omposition and {A}nalysis}, volume = {64}, numero = {2}, pages = {163--170}, ISSN = {0889-1575}, year = {2017}, DOI = {10.1016/j.jfca.2017.09.001}, URL = {https://www.documentation.ird.fr/hor/fdi:010071940}, }
